Abstract

The utility model discloses one kind identifying hand touch switches for intelligent steering, including push-button socket, the upper surface of push-button socket offers the first mounting groove, button is slidably connected in first mounting groove, the side wall of button offers symmetrical slot, it is fixedly connected with spring leaf in two slots, the one end of spring leaf far from slot slot bottom is connected with fixed block, the side wall of push-button socket offers symmetrical mounting hole, the side wall of push-button socket is set there are two symmetrical push plate, two push plates are connected by two springs with the lateral wall of push-button socket, push plate is connected with push rod close to the side of push-button socket, the one end of push rod far from push plate is run through the lateral wall of push-button socket and is extended in mounting hole.The utility model is simple in structure, easy to operate, realizes convenient for the installation and removal to button.

Technical field
The utility model is related to intelligent steering identification technology fields, more particularly to a kind of intelligent steering that is used for identify hand touch Switch.
Background technology
Intelligent steering identifies hand touch switches, and by the way that push button is arranged, who first presses a button, and who just has the right and equipment human-computer interaction, Equipment just meeting speech recognition, is authorized to operate that people has no idea to operate not the other side that presses a button, in this way in voice when others talks Play one in conversational mode and effectively carry out order and use, and also have the function of to electricity by clearance-type it is energy saving, But button is dismantled and is reinstalled using needing for a long time.
Utility model content
The button that hand touch switches are identified purpose of the utility model is to solve intelligent steering in the prior art is not easy The problem of disassembly and installation, and the one kind proposed identifies hand touch switches for intelligent steering.

Specific implementation mode
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.
In the description of the present invention, it should be understood that term "upper", "lower", "front", "rear", "left", "right", The orientation or positional relationship of the instructions such as "top", "bottom", "inner", "outside" is to be based on the orientation or positional relationship shown in the drawings, and is only The utility model and simplifying describes for ease of description, do not indicate or imply the indicated device or element must have it is specific Orientation, with specific azimuth configuration and operation, therefore should not be understood as limiting the present invention.
Referring to Fig.1-2, a kind of to identify hand touch switches, including push-button socket 1 for intelligent steering, which is characterized in that button The upper surface of seat 1 offers the first mounting groove 2, button 3 is slidably connected in the first mounting groove 2, the side wall of button 3 offers phase Symmetrical slot 4 is fixedly connected with spring leaf 5 in two slots 4, and the one end of spring leaf 5 far from 4 slot bottom of slot is connected with fixation Block 6, the side wall of push-button socket 1 offer symmetrical mounting hole 7, and the side wall of push-button socket 1 is set there are two symmetrical push plate 8, and two A push plate 8 is connected by two the first springs 9 with the lateral wall of push-button socket 1, and push plate 8 is connected close to the side of push-button socket 1 Have a push rod 10, the one end of push rod 10 far from push plate 8 through push-button socket 1 lateral wall and extend in mounting hole 7, when needing to dismantle When button 3, push plate 8 is pushed by push rod 10, fixed block 6 is released into mounting hole 7, when needing to install button 3, pins button 3 It is pushed, fixed block 6 is fixed in mounting hole 7, you can button 3 is fixed.
The lower wall of button 3 offers the second mounting groove 11, and there are two symmetrical for the connection of 11 side wall of the second mounting groove One fixture block 12, there are two second springs 13 for the connection of 11 slot bottom of the second mounting groove, and two second springs 13 are far from the second mounting groove 11 One end of slot bottom is connected with fixed plate 14 jointly, and the lower wall of fixed plate 14 is rotatably connected to fixed link 15, the side of fixed link 15 Wall is connected with symmetrical second fixture block 16, and the one end of fixed link 15 far from fixed plate 14 is connected with the slot bottom of the first mounting groove 2, By pushing button 3, since fixed link 15 and fixed plate 14 are slidably connected, therefore the second fixture block 16 is connected to the by turn knob 3 One fixture block, 12 top, since second spring 13 there are elastic force therefore can fix button 3.
The side wall of slot 4 offers symmetrical sliding slot 17, and fixed block 6 is connected by two sliding blocks 18 and the sliding of sliding slot 17 It connects.
The upper side wall of button 3 is equipped with non-slip mat.
Button 3 is electrically connected by conducting wire with intelligent steering mark, and intelligent conduction is identified as the prior art, does not do herein superfluous It states.
In the utility model, when needing to install button 3, pins button 3 and pushed, fixed block 6 is fixed on fixation Hole 7 can fix it, and by pushing button 3, since fixed link 15 and fixed plate 14 are slidably connected, therefore turn knob 3 is by the Two fixture blocks 16 are connected to 12 top of the first fixture block, since second spring 13 there are elastic force therefore can fix button, when needs are torn open When unloading button 3, push plate 8 is pushed by push rod 10, fixed block 6 is released into mounting hole 7, the second fixture block 16 is detached from by turn knob 3 First fixture block, 12 top, you can realize the installation and removal to button 3.
